132

The Advertising Regulatory Council of Nigeria (ARCON) has banned the use of foreign voice-over artists and models effective Saturday, 1 October 2022. In a statement, ARCON Director General, Dr Olalekan Fadolapo said the ban was in line with the Federal Government’s policy to develop local talent and inclusive economic growth for sectors of the country, including advertising. “ARCON, being the …
